Root cause: integration testing with the Bramford billing stack surfaced reconciliation errors. Vendor fix is in progress; revised cutover date confirmed by the steering group. Sales impact: hold all go-live commitments to prospects until further notice. Pipeline messaging guidance comes from marketing Thursday. No budget overrun expected; contingency covers the extension. Weekly status resumes Monday. Please review the confidential planning note appended below before client conversations.

internal memo for yahaf-yajep: Only 7 of the 100 pilot accounts renewed Oliix, so a churn review is set for October 15.

Internal memo — Dispatch Desk
Re: Exhibition pieces on loan, Ashenmoor Gallery

The three loaned pieces from the Varrow Collection are crated and awaiting return transport from our east store. Condition reports are attached to each crate and must travel with them; the gallery registrar will not accept delivery without matching paperwork. Crates are climate-sensitive, so schedule the run for early morning and avoid the uncovered dock. The courier hand-over is to proceed as follows.

courier memo of yawep-yafog: the pramir ulaix courier leaves the ulavan aldix frair zorok oliiel joreth rusdor fenvan ledger at gate 1305 under passcode 514738

### Runbook: CSV Import Wizard (Fernhollow)

If the wizard stalls at the mapping step, check that headers are unique and under 64 characters. Re-uploads keep prior mappings unless the schema changed. Escalate parse failures over 5% of rows to the data team, quoting the wizard build shown below.

pipeline stamp: htk14_378fd70323001d

Team — starting with tonight's cut, the Brindlecast notifier service moves to 1-in-50 log sampling for its heartbeat and retry messages. Full logging stays on for errors and anything touching the dead-letter path. If you ever need to debug a sampled-out window, the raw stream is retained for 72 hours in cold storage. The sampling config was baked into the build identified below.

session token of bafop-baweg = htk14_c985fcc5c92ff4